It looks like one of the Habs' young forwards has decided to leave the team momentarily. According to Eyes On The Prize's Andrew Zadarnowski, Daniel Carr is taking a personal leave to sort some personal problems.

We have yet to know more about the nature of those problems:


The 6-foot, 194-pound forward joined the Habs as an undrafted free agent, back in 2014. Since then, he played 56 games over two seasons with the Canadiens, between 2015 and 2017. Last season, he scored two goals and seven assists for nine points in 33 games.
